How Common Is The Last Name Golecki?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 481,056th most commonly held last name on a worldwide basis. It is borne by approximately 1 in 10,515,939 people. It occurs mostly in Europe, where 90 percent of Golecki are found; 84 percent are found in Eastern Europe and 84 percent are found in West Slavic Europe.
The last name Golecki is most widely held in Poland, where it is held by 583 people, or 1 in 65,195. Beside Poland Golecki is found in 10 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 8 percent live and Germany, where 5 percent live.
